How to design a comfy 40 square meter apartment in 2023
How to live large in a small 40 square meter apartment

Introduction

Living in a small apartment can be challenging, especially when it comes to designing a comfortable and functional space. However, with the right tips and tricks, you can transform your 40 square meter apartment into a cozy and inviting home. In this article, we will explore various design ideas and solutions to make the most out of your limited space.

1. Optimize Your Layout

One of the key factors in designing a small apartment is to optimize the layout. Start by identifying the different zones you need in your space, such as the living area, bedroom, kitchen, and dining area. Consider using multifunctional furniture, such as a sofa bed or a dining table with built-in storage, to maximize the functionality of your apartment.

2. Use Light Colors

Light colors can make a small space appear larger and more open. Opt for neutral shades like white, beige, or light gray for your walls and furniture. You can add pops of color through accessories and decorations to create a lively and vibrant atmosphere.

3. Utilize Mirrors

Mirrors are a great way to visually expand a small apartment. Place large mirrors strategically across from windows or in narrow hallways to create an illusion of depth and amplify the natural light. This simple trick can make your space feel more spacious and airy.

4. Embrace Natural Light

Maximize the natural light in your apartment by keeping windows unobstructed. Avoid heavy curtains or blinds that block out sunlight. Instead, opt for sheer or light-filtering curtains that allow natural light to fill the space. Natural light not only makes your apartment feel brighter but also enhances the overall ambiance.

5. Declutter and Organize

A cluttered space can make even the largest apartment feel cramped. Take the time to declutter and organize your belongings. Get rid of items you no longer need or use and find storage solutions for the essentials. Utilize under-bed storage, floating shelves, and hanging organizers to keep your apartment tidy and free of unnecessary clutter.

6. Create Zones

Divide your apartment into different zones to optimize functionality. Use rugs, furniture placement, or room dividers to define separate areas for sleeping, lounging, dining, and working. This will make your apartment feel more organized and spacious.

7. Choose Practical Furniture

When selecting furniture for your small apartment, prioritize practicality and functionality. Look for pieces that serve multiple purposes, such as a storage ottoman or a coffee table with built-in shelves. Opt for furniture with clean lines and minimalistic designs to create a visually uncluttered look.

8. Utilize Vertical Space

Make use of your vertical space by installing shelves or wall-mounted storage units. This will not only free up valuable floor space but also provide additional storage options for books, decorative items, or kitchen essentials. Vertical storage is a great solution for small apartments with limited square footage.

9. Add Personal Touches

Lastly, don’t forget to add personal touches to make your apartment feel like home. Display artwork, photographs, or souvenirs that hold sentimental value. Incorporate plants or flowers to bring life and freshness into your space. Small details can make a big difference in creating a comfortable and cozy atmosphere.
